| The zip iterator provides the ability to parallel-iterate |
| over several controlled sequences simultaneously. A zip |
| iterator is constructed from a tuple of iterators. Moving |
| the zip iterator moves all the iterators in parallel. |
| Dereferencing the zip iterator returns a tuple that contains |
| the results of dereferencing the individual iterators. |
| |
| The tuple of iterators is now implemented in terms of a Boost fusion sequence. |
| Because of this the 'tuple' may be any Boost fusion sequence and, for backwards |
| compatibility through a Boost fusion sequence adapter, a Boost tuple. Because the |
| 'tuple' may be any boost::fusion sequence the 'tuple' may also be any type for which a |
| Boost fusion adapter exists. This includes, among others, a std::tuple and a std::pair. |
| Just remember to include the appropriate Boost fusion adapter header files for these |
| other Boost fusion adapters. The zip_iterator header file already includes the |
| Boost fusion adapter header file for Boost tuple, so you need not include it yourself |
| to use a Boost tuple as your 'tuple'. |
